RADIO CONTROLLED CLOCK
WITH PROJECTOR
USER’S INSTRUCTIONS
GETTING STARTED
1. If using the DC Adaptor to power
the clock, plug the adaptor into
the left side of the clock. If using
battery, install 2 AA size
batteries into the battery
compartment, pay attention to
the polarity.
2. When the clock is power on, all
the segments of the LCD will be
shown briefly before entering the
radio controlled time reception
mode.
3. The RC clock will automatically
start scanning for the radio
controlled time reception mode.
Note:
1. If there is no display on the LCD
after inserting the battery, press
RESET key by using a metal pin.
Due to atmospheric disturbances,
the clock may not receive the
signal immediately, try to reset
the clock again during night time.
2. If using battery and DC Adaptor
at the same time, the unit will
automatically select the Adaptor
Power for both clock and
projector.
FUNCTION KEYS
SNOOZE/LIGHT key:
- Turn the projector and EL on.
Stop the current alarm when the
bell is ringing.
MODE key:
- Switch between normal time
mode and alarm time mode.
SET key:
- In normal time mode, toggle
between ºC/ºF temperature
format.
- In setting mode, step the setting
items.
ADJUST key:
- Toggle between Date/Month and
Year display.
- In alarm time mode, switch
ALARM/SNOOZE function on or
off.
- In setting mode, adjust the value
of the flashing digit.
RECEIVE key:
- Press it to receive the signal for
reception testing. If the signal is
in acceptable signal quality in the
first 30 seconds, leave the clock
there. Otherwise, place it in other
positions and press it again.
RESET key:
- In case of mal-function, use a pin
to press the RESET key to re-
start the clock.
FOCUS key:
- Adjust the clearness of the
projector.

ABOUT THE DAYLIGHT SAVING
TIME (DST)
The clock has been programmed to
automatically switch when daylight
saving time is in effect. Your clock
will show “DST” during the summer.
SIGNAL STRENGTH INDICATOR
The signal indicator displays signal
strength in 4 levels. Wave segment
flashing means time signals are
being received. The signal quality
could be classified into four types:
If the RC clock receives signal
successfully, a Sync-time symbol
”appears on LCD. The unit is
already synchronized with the time
signal transmitter. Otherwise the
antenna segment will disappear from
the LCD display.
Note:
You may use the RECEIVE button to
receive the time signal manually. The
receive mode will stop automatically
after 6-12minutes. Test mode
consumes more battery power that
may reduce battery lifetime.
